Output 76e4e55d4491e76a9a37ed04659d13b7414ae8acdc07c51abfc7e8760deb87e0:0

value
436767265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f63e4701e1285544eb0929c69df9e37e40b268c OP_EQUAL
address
3BqzbUgaGfVhxzMhst88gkBVvGYjDYtkNi
transaction
76e4e55d4491e76a9a37ed04659d13b7414ae8acdc07c51abfc7e8760deb87e0
confirmations
531329
spent
true